A hotshoe flash will work perfectly well (make sure you read your camera manual to find out if you need to turn off a pre-flash).
Just set it on minimum power and either cover up most of the flash with a piece of card, or fit a red gel over the top. A card will reduce the power to the point where it doesn't create a significant extra light source and a red gel will pretty much turn it into an infra red transmitter.
But an infra red transmitter is less than ideal, because it requires (almost) line of sight with the sensor on one of your flash heads, so in some circumstances it won't work.
And a PC adapter/synch cord is very must yesterdays technology - inconvenient and unreliable. Your best bet is a radio trigger, many of the cheap ones cost a lot less than the Chinese IR trigger you found.
